Program Overview

The Tanzania Education Co-operation Organization (TEC.ORG) is implementing the Afforestation Program (2024–2025) to promote environmental conservation through large-scale tree planting and ecosystem restoration in the Kilimanjaro Region, particularly around the slopes of Mount Kilimanjaro. The program is designed to combat deforestation, restore degraded landscapes, improve biodiversity, and strengthen community resilience to climate change. Through collaboration with local communities, schools, government institutions, environmental organizations, and volunteers, TEC.ORG is helping to protect one of Africa’s most important natural ecosystems.

Program Period

2024 – 2025

Location

Kilimanjaro Moshi – Shanty Town

Main Activity

Tree Planting

Focus Area

Mount Kilimanjaro Ecosystem

Program Objectives

  • Restore degraded forests and landscapes around Mount Kilimanjaro.
  • Increase tree cover to improve biodiversity and ecosystem health.
  • Reduce the effects of climate change through carbon sequestration.
  • Protect water catchment areas and natural resources.
  • Promote environmental education and community participation.
  • Encourage schools and youth groups to engage in conservation activities.
  • Support sustainable environmental management for future generations.

Key Activities

  • Tree seedling production and distribution.
  • Community tree planting campaigns.
  • School environmental clubs and awareness programs.
  • Forest restoration initiatives.
  • Environmental education workshops.
  • Monitoring and maintenance of planted trees.
  • Partnerships with conservation organizations and local authorities.

Expected Impact

The Afforestation Program aims to restore natural ecosystems, improve environmental sustainability, reduce land degradation, and enhance climate resilience in the Kilimanjaro Region. By increasing forest cover and encouraging community ownership of conservation efforts, the program contributes to cleaner air, improved water resources, biodiversity conservation, and sustainable livelihoods.
